Weedsport Police Department Records
Police records in Weedsport, New York may include arrest records, incident reports, accident reports, traffic crash reports, service call logs, citations, and booking information. Weedsport is a village, not a city; records are generally held by the Village of Weedsport Police Department for local incidents it handles, and by the Cayuga County Sheriff’s Office or New York State Police for county or state-handled calls. The agency that responded to the event is usually the agency to contact. Members of the public may request available records under New York’s Freedom of Information Law, while involved parties may have additional access to certain reports. Release depends on record availability, identity and privacy protections, sealed or restricted information, and whether the case is still active or under investigation.
How to Request Police Records in Weedsport
To request police records in Weedsport, contact the agency that handled the incident, such as the Village of Weedsport Police Department, the Cayuga County Sheriff’s Office, or New York State Police. Requests may usually be made through a FOIL request form or online portal, in person, by mail, by email, or by phone to ask where to send the request. Provide the incident date, report number if known, location, names of involved people, and the type of report requested, such as an accident report or incident report. Copy fees may apply, including per-page charges, certified copy fees, or the actual cost of producing digital records. Under New York public records law, an agency must generally acknowledge a written FOIL request within five business days and then provide the record, deny it, or give an estimated response date. The agency may contact you by phone, email, or mail if it needs clarification. Some records may be redacted, delayed, or denied, especially those involving open investigations, juveniles, protected personal information, or court restrictions, which is normal under New York public records law.

What is included in a police record from Weedsport?
A police record may include an incident report, arrest record, accident or crash report, call details, citation information, booking details, officer narratives, and related case numbers. The exact contents depend on the agency that handled the event and what can legally be released.
Are police records in New York public?
Many police records are available through New York’s Freedom of Information Law, but access is not automatic for every record. Agencies may withhold or redact records involving active investigations, juveniles, sealed cases, medical information, personal privacy, or court-ordered restrictions.
How long does it take to get a police report in Weedsport?
For a written FOIL request, a New York agency generally must acknowledge the request within five business days. The full response time depends on the age of the record, the amount of review needed, whether redactions are required, and whether the case is still active.
How do I find arrest records in Weedsport without going to the police station?
You can contact the responding agency by phone or check whether it accepts requests by email, mail, or an online FOIL portal. For Weedsport, start with the Village of Weedsport Police Department if it handled the matter, or the Cayuga County Sheriff’s Office or New York State Police for incidents handled by those agencies.
Can I look up someone’s arrest history in Weedsport online?
Some recent arrest or court-related information may appear on official agency, county, or court websites, but complete arrest history is not always available online. For official records, submit a request to the agency that created the record or check the appropriate court for case information.
